Output e23ba58a49ddabfefb84b430c1aa3b67277c24961a38e07e27a30e24d5d39ff0:0

value
1471076
script pubkey
OP_0 OP_PUSHBYTES_20 cd7741754772b61df161c91d90fc35a98d902caf
address
bc1qe4m5za28w2mpmutpeyweplp44xxeqt90dlazqp
transaction
e23ba58a49ddabfefb84b430c1aa3b67277c24961a38e07e27a30e24d5d39ff0